SLOW-COOKED BREAKFAST APPLE COBBLER



Slow-Cooked Breakfast Apple Cobbler image

Serve them cobbler on Christmas morning-or any other cold morning. You can peel the apples if you like. -Marietta Slater, Justin, Texas

Provided by Taste of Home

Categories     Breakfast     Brunch

Time 8h15m

Yield 6 servings.

Number Of Ingredients 7

6 medium apples, cut into 1/2-inch wedges
1 tablespoon butter
3 tablespoons honey
1/2 teaspoon ground cinnamon
1/4 cup dried cranberries
2 cups granola without raisins
Milk and maple syrup, optional

Steps:

  • Place apples in a greased 3-qt. slow cooker. In a microwave, melt butter; stir in honey and cinnamon. Drizzle over apples. Sprinkle cranberries and granola over top., Cook, covered, on low until apples are tender, 6-8 hours. If desired, serve with milk and syrup.

Nutrition Facts : Calories 289 calories, Fat 8g fat (1g saturated fat), Cholesterol 5mg cholesterol, Sodium 31mg sodium, Carbohydrate 58g carbohydrate (31g sugars, Fiber 11g fiber), Protein 7g protein.

APPLE PEAR BREAKFAST COBBLER FOR THE CROCK POT



Apple Pear Breakfast Cobbler for the Crock Pot image

This is THE BEST crock pot breakfast I've ever had! There is nothing better than treating the family to a delicious hot breakfast before sending them out into the chilly world.

Provided by HeathersKitchen

Categories     Breakfast

Time 8h20m

Yield 6 serving(s)

Number Of Ingredients 10

3 apples
3 pears
1/3 cup brown sugar
1 tablespoon flour
1 tablespoon lemon juice
1/3 cup apple cider
1 teaspoon ground cinnamon
1 teaspoon apple pie spice
2 tablespoons butter
3 cups granola cereal (with or ithout raisins)

Steps:

  • Spray crockpot with nonstick cooking spray.
  • Peel, core and slice into 8ths the apples and pears.
  • Put the prepared fruit into the crock pot.
  • In a jar with a tight fitting lid put the brown sugar, flour, lemon juice, apple cider, and spices.
  • Put the lid on the jar and shake the jar vigorously until there are no more lumps.
  • Pour over fruit and stir to coat.
  • Dot the tops of apples and pears with 2 T of butter.
  • Spread the granola evenly over the fruit.
  • Cover.
  • Cook on low 6-8 hours.
  • Turn off crock pot, remove lid, and allow to cool 10 minutes before serving.
  • Serve with milk for breakfast or ice cream as a dessert.
  • *We've had it with a bit of ice cream even for breakfast! :).

CROCK POT BREAKFAST APPLE COBBLER



Crock Pot Breakfast Apple Cobbler image

This makes a great breakfast or dessert for 2. Put it on before bed and its ready in the morning and the house smells like apples.

Provided by PollyB

Categories     Breakfast

Time 9h15m

Yield 2 serving(s)

Number Of Ingredients 5

4 medium apples, peeled and sliced (about 2 cups)
1/4 cup honey
1 teaspoon cinnamon
2 tablespoons butter, melted
2 cups granola cereal

Steps:

  • Place apples in slow cooker and mix in remaining ingredients.
  • Cover and cook on low 7 to 9 hours (overnight) or on high 2 to 3 hours.
  • Serve with milk.

BREAKFAST APPLE COBBLER



Breakfast Apple Cobbler image

This is a Yummy hot filling breakfast for kids and adults. tastes like dessert but is a healthy breakfast. Prepare the night before to have a filling hot breakfast on hectic mornings.

Provided by Joan Hunt

Categories     Fruit Breakfast

Time 9h15m

Number Of Ingredients 6

8 medium apples, cored, peeled, sliced
1/4 c sugar(i used raw cane sugar)
dash(es) cinnamon
1 juice of lemon
1/4 c vegan margarine, melted
2 c granola

Steps:

  • 1. combine ingredients in slow cooker.
  • 2. cover. Cook on low 7-9 hours(while you sleep!), or on high 2-3 hours(after you're up in the morning).
